"The Byzantine Fault Tolerance In Consensus Algorithms"
Assalam O Alaikum |
---|
Hello Steemians! Well come to my post. How are you all? I hope that you will be doing well by the grace of Almighty Allah. I'm also fine and enjoying my day. Today I'm here to share my knowledge about "The Byzantine Fault Tolerance In Consensus Algorithms" in this Steem Alliance connect. So let's start the task without any more delay of time.
What is byzantine fault tolerance in consensus algorithms? |
---|
Friends the byzantine fault tolerance is the ability of a digital or Blockchain network system to work properly even when many faults occur in its working or system. It is that practical which is very useful to build the trust of people over any certain platform as it ensure its security and transparency. The reason is that when any threat occur in a Blockchain system the information and users data remain safe due to the presence of BFTs in that network. It is also very useful in validating transactions by achieving the consensus of people on a network.
In the BFTs algorithms there are special type of nodes present which allow the system to work properly and these nodes are known as Practice Byzantine Fault Tolerance (PBFTs) and Byzantine Fault Tolerance Replication (BFTRs). These nodes are designed to produce resistance against the certain byzantine faults which are produced in a network due to several reasons. So we can say that the BFTs plays a vital role in ensuring and maintaining the integrity and security of a network.
The byzantine Fault Tolerance algorithms can be implanted in several digital networks such as Decentralized and Blockchain networks, in defi platforms and projects as well. The reason is that their implementation allows a network to work smoothy even during the presence of any byzantine fault in that system. So now let's have a look at some benefits of byzantine fault tolerance algorithms.
Benefits of BFTs in Blockchain networks |
---|
1. Resilience:
- The presence of BFTs algorithms in a Blockchain network allow it to work properly as they produce resistance against the faulty nodes and other byzantine faults which may disrupt the working of a Blockchain network.
2. Security:
- The BFTs algorithms make a Blockchain network even secure as it keep all the information and data safe during the Cybil attacks etc. In addition it also allow the overall security and interoperability of a Blockchain network.
3. Promote Decentralization:
- The BFTs algorithms improve the Decentralization of a Blockchain network as when the a byzantine fault is present in a specific nodes than it allow the other nodes to work properly and maintain stability of a network.
4. Improve Scalability:
- The scalability of a Blockchain network can be solved due to the presence of BFTs in them. This is because it can bear the load of a large number of transactions and also it can validate tham successfully even when other nodes aren't working properly.
5. Maintain Trust:
- The BFTs algorithms plays a vital role in maintaining the trust of people on a certain platform. The reason is that during byzantine faults some of nodes stopped their working which may interrupt the working of network and thus the trust of people may loss. So the BFTs algorithms keep on working and ensuring overall wellbeing of a Blockchain network and thus the trust of people increase.
Conclusion |
---|
In conclusion the byzantine Fault Tolerance algorithms plays a vital role in maintaining the integrity, security and transparency of a network by bearing the load of detected nodes due to byzantine faults. But achieving BFTs algorithms may be difficult as a certain things are required for their working and implantation but however they are very useful in building the trust of people and allow a network to work properly and smoothly. So friends in that article we have discussed about the byzantine Fault Tolerance algorithms and their benefits. I hope it will be helpful for you.
x Share
Note:- ✅
Regards,
@jueco
Thanks bro for your kind evaluation 😊